Official Details
The Indian Wells tournament—officially known as the BNP Paribas Open—is a major stop on the ATP and WTA tours, attracting the world’s top tennis talent. The televised draw will take place on Monday at 12 PM PST and will be broadcast across various platforms, ensuring that fans have direct access to the matchup announcements. The scope of this initiative spans not just the draw itself but also features player interviews and expert analysis, showcasing the significance of this event in the tennis calendar.
